JOB OVERVIEW

Maintain compliance with all regulatory and accrediting institutions
Monitor medical/non-medical staff credentials and licenses
Advise staff on renewal procedures
Participate in the development of internal credentialing processes
Keep records in licenses, credentials and insurance contracts
Release information to agencies and members of the public as required by law
Work closely with key stakeholder to resolve operational issues in specified time frames related to payer and provider contracts.
Show a strong understanding of contract structure and terms. Serves as facilitator for the resolution of complex contract interpretation. Interface with payers on disputes related to contract interpretation.
Utilize strong communication skills, both written and oral required to research, identify root cause by communicating at various levels within the organization, consolidating the issues, and sharing the resolution.
Utilize strong organizations skills required to manage and prioritize work including multiple priorities at the same time. Tracking and communicating current workload and open issues on a regular basis to key stakeholders and leaders.
May participate with negotiators during contract negotiations, on payer issues.
Track issues identified by Revenue Cycle and other stakeholders, where system is unable to be set up correctly to administer language correctly. In collaboration with key stakeholders, develop correction action plan.
Support the annual payer contract renewal and payer notification process.
Responsible for overall contract document maintenance.
